WALL TOWNSHIP, N.J. — Authorities are investigating a home invasion early Monday morning that led to a police pursuit ending on the Garden State Parkway, officials said.
At approximately 4:44 a.m. on January 20, 2025, Wall Township Police responded to a report of a burglary in progress at a residence on Baileys Corner Road. According to police, three masked individuals forcibly entered the home by breaking open a rear window.
The suspects reportedly stole car keys from a counter inside the home but failed to take the vehicle from the property before the homeowner contacted law enforcement. Surveillance footage from the home corroborated the victim’s account of the break-in.
Patrol officers located a blue Nissan Altima with dark tinted windows traveling west on Allaire Road shortly after the suspects fled. The vehicle continued northbound onto the Garden State Parkway after officers attempted a traffic stop, police said. The pursuit was called off due to safety concerns.
The Wall Township Police Detective Bureau is actively investigating the incident and reviewing the footage to identify the suspects. Police believe the individuals may have been in the area before the reported burglary.
